This is false for a number of reasons. While LH (which stands for Leutinizing Hormone) is released by the anterior pituitary gland and can be present in both females and males, it play a more predominant role in females. Working closely with FSH (Follicle Stimulating Hormone) a surge in LH begins the process of ovulation and the development of the Corpeus Leuteum.
In Males it is used both for the production of sperm but to stimulate the production of testosterone.

<h3>What do you mean by spontaneous generation theory?</h3>
According to the hypothesis of spontaneous generation, the emergence of life things from nonliving materials was both common and predictable. It was proposed that some forms, like fleas, may develop from inanimate substances like dust or that maggots could develop from decomposing human flesh.
